A window installation company will assist you in choosing between a pocket or full frame installation. Full-frame installations require replacing the entire window including the frame, trim and sill. They are typically required in cases where you require a fresh design or if your existing window is severely rotted. Pocket windows can be replaced without removing the original frame, which is easier and less expensive. Hydrophobic Coating

Hydrophobic coatings are a type of surface treatment that blocks water from a surface, thereby decreasing maintenance costs. It also helps prevent stains, corrosion, and the etching process. It can be applied to a wide variety of surfaces including glass. It is used in many industries that include aerospace, automotive and construction. In addition to repelling water the coating also increases the visibility and safety.

Hydrophobic coatings can be applied on glass surfaces to create an automatic cleaning effect. It can also shield against scratches during cleaning procedures. This is particularly crucial for aircraft windows, where a scratched windshield can impede the pilot's vision, and can impair visibility.

The coating has a low surface tension which reduces the amount of force required to apply it to a surface. It can be applied to almost any surface including transparent and glass materials. The coating can be sprayed on or applied using brushes and rollers. In either case, you should select a product that is safe to apply to the substrate.

The surface of hydrophobic coatings is usually smooth, but it can be altered to ensure that the coating is more or less roughness. The roughness of the coating affects its ability to repel water. Coatings that have contact angles of 150 degrees or more are considered super-hydrophobic.

Foggy windows can be difficult to live with, and if the problem isn't resolved quickly, it can result in mold and mildew issues. Window experts can remove the fog by using a specific defogging method which involves drilling two or more small holes in the bottom of the window in order to allow moisture to escape and dry the panes' interiors.
